The issues between the two men stretch back decades and tensions have been simmering ever since.
While appearing on The Overlap's Stick to Football podcast, Keane re-ignited the feud when asked about the infamous red card he received during an incident with McAteer during Manchester United's 1-1 draw with Sunderland in 2002.Just months after the Saipan debacle, Keane and McAteer went at each other for 90 minutes with the United captain seeing red in injury time for an alleged elbow on his International teammate.
"Just because you play with someone doesn't mean you're mates. Do you know what, he was one of these players who shout their mouths off.
